A versatile 7-footer who was a second-team Associated Press All-American in his only college season, Holmgren averaged 14.1 points and 9.9 rebounds per game and ranked fourth nationally with 3.7 blocks per game for the Zags. He traveled to Oklahoma City the next day and was diagnosed with a Lisfranc injury, which affects the ligaments and sometimes the bones of the midfoot. Chet Thomas Holmgren (born May 1, 2002; pronounced / tt homrn / CHET HOHM-grn [1]) is an American professional basketball player for the Oklahoma City Thunder of the National Basketball Association (NBA). Chet Holmgren will miss the 2022-23 season after suffering a right foot injury while contesting LeBron James' layup at the CrawsOver Pro-Am in Seattle on Saturday. To help Holmgren cope, Thunder Coach Mark Daigneault gave him a copy of Mans Search for Meaning. That best-selling 1946 book, written by Viktor Frankl, a Holocaust survivor, emphasizes finding meaning amid suffering.
